Job Description
- Security advice to client
- Threat and Risk assessment
- Client liaison and professional client relationship
- Manpower Management
- Equipment Management
- Effectively dealing with and managing client complaints
- Ensure that contractual requirements are always met
- Initiating and chairing disciplinary hearings
- Incident and investigation management
- Ensure compliance to the Company’s disciplinary code
- Knowledge of Health & Safety management
- Ensuring Security Officers problems that are reported are solved
- Ensure that all company / client SOP’s are followed
- Ensure BPC policies and procedures are always followed
- Ensure that training takes place as and when required to increase and sustain the performance and productivity of the staff
- After hour visits and standby duties
- Completion of daily, weekly and monthly reports
- Assisting with shift changes as a standby manager
- Must be able to attend meetings and take calls to assist with matter of urgency even on rest days
- Demonstrate extensive knowledge of good security practice covering the physical and logical aspects of information products, systems, integrity, and confidentiality
Preferred qualifications/attributes/skills:
- 5 years’ minimum experience in the mining environment
- Security Management Diploma with a Security B-Tech Degree or equivalent.
- Illegal Mining experience
- Must have experience in investigations of criminal cases and internal mine related cases.
- SAPS experience will be an advantage.
- PSIRA certification – Grade A
- Grade 12 or equivalent qualification
- Competency for all 3 firearms
- Relevant experience in a managerial or similar position. Not less than 10 years as a Contract Manager in a Mining Environment.
- Must have confidence in dealing with the public and community unrest.
- Bilingual (English and any other South African Language).
- The ability to work under pressure.
- First aid and fire-fighting training will be advantageous.
- Excellent written & verbal communication skills.
- Computer literate and knowledge of MS office.
- Own accommodation
- Own transport
- Must be willing to undergo polygraph test.
- Clean disciplinary, criminal and credit record.
